										<content:encoded><![CDATA[<p><strong>LTO (Lithium Titanate) </strong>batteries are designed for applications where <strong>extreme lifespan</strong>, <strong>ultra‑fast charging</strong>, and <strong>maximum reliability</strong> are essential. Compared to other lithium chemistries, LTO technology stands out for its <strong>excellent cycle performance</strong>, <strong>superior thermal stability</strong>, and highly safe behavior even under <strong>demanding operating conditions.</strong> </p>
<p>Thanks to their durability and robustness, LTO batteries are ideal for <strong>critical systems</strong>, <strong>industrial applications,</strong> <strong>energy backup,</strong> automation,<strong> specialized mobility</strong>, <strong>telecommunications</strong>, and equipment requiring <strong>high availability</strong> and <strong>reduced maintenance</strong>. They are also particularly suitable for designs where <strong>fast charging</strong> or <strong>resistance to harsh environments</strong> are key factors. </p>

										<content:encoded><![CDATA[<p><strong>Lead–carbon batteries </strong>combine the robustness of lead‑acid technology with improved cycling performance thanks to the incorporation of carbon in the electrode. This technology is aimed at applications that require <strong>reliable, cost‑effective energy storage with strong partial‑state‑of‑charge resistance,</strong> making it especially suitable for <strong>backup power </strong>and <strong>stationary systems.</strong> </p>
<p>Compared to conventional lead‑acid solutions, lead–carbon batteries stand out for their <strong>greater durability</strong>, their ability to <strong>recover after partial discharges</strong>, and their improved behavior in <strong>repetitive charge–discharge cycling</strong>. This makes them a very attractive option for <strong>telecommunications</strong>, solar storage, <strong>UPS systems</strong>, <strong>signaling</strong>, <strong>security,</strong> <strong>auxiliary power,</strong> and <strong>industrial infrastructure.</strong> </p>
<p>As an intermediate option between traditional sealed lead‑acid and more advanced chemistries, they offer an <strong>excellent cost‑performance ratio</strong>. 										<content:encoded><![CDATA[<p><strong>Na⁺ (Sodium‑ion) batteries</strong> are emerging as an alternative to lithium technologies, particularly suitable for applications that require a <strong>balance of safety, sustainability, thermal stability, and competitive cost.</strong> By using sodium, an abundant and accessible resource, they become an attractive option for <strong>stationary energy storage,</strong> industrial equipment, backup solutions, and certain light‑mobility applications. </p>
<p>They stand out for their <strong>operational robustness</strong>, <strong>good service life</strong>, and <strong>stable behavior</strong> in environments where <strong>safety and reliability</strong> are priorities. They also help <strong>reduce dependence on critical raw materials</strong> in the global supply chain. </p>

										<content:encoded><![CDATA[<p>EC fans combine the efficiency of a brushless motor with the precision of electronic control, delivering <strong>superior performance in industrial cooling systems and electronics.</strong></p>
<p>Available in axial formats from <strong>60×25 mm to 280×80 mm</strong>, they provide <strong>stable airflow</strong>, <strong>low noise levels</strong>, and <strong>significantly reduced energy consumption</strong> compared to traditional AC fans.</p>
<p>Their compact architecture and adjustable control capabilities make them suitable for integration into equipment where thermal reliability is critical: power supplies, chargers, BMS units, electrical cabinets, telecommunications systems, and industrial automation.</p>
<p>Thanks to their <strong>integrated electronics</strong>, EC fans maintain a <strong>constant speed even under voltage fluctuations</strong>, extending system lifespan and reducing maintenance costs.</p>
